UniPathway: a resource for the exploration and annotation of metabolic pathways
UniPathway (http://www.unipathway.org) is a fully manually curated resource for the representation and annotation of metabolic pathways. UniPathway provides explicit representations of enzyme-catalyzed and spontaneous chemical reactions, as well as a hierarchical representation of metabolic pathways. This hierarchy uses linear subpathways as the basic building block for the assembly of larger and more complex pathways, including species-specific pathway variants. All of the pathway data in UniPathway has been extensively cross-linked to existing pathway resources such as KEGG and MetaCyc, as well as sequence resources such as the UniProt KnowledgeBase (UniProtKB), for which UniPathway provides a controlled vocabulary for pathway annotation. FAKTOR – FAKTOR YANG MEMPENGARUHI PROFITABILITAS PERUSAHAAN SEKTOR FARMASI YANG TERDAFTAR DI BURSA EFEK INDONESIA TAHUN 2013 - 2016
Penelitian ini bertujuan untuk melakukan pengujian tentang Faktor – Faktor Yang Mempengaruhi Profitabilitas Perusahaan Sektor Farmasi Yang Terdaftar Di Bursa Efek Indonesia Tahun 2013 - 2016. Jumlah sampel yang digunakan dalam penelitian ini sebanyak 32 data perusahaan. Teknik analisis data yang digunakan untuk menguji hipotesis adalah dengan menggunakan Partial Least Square ( PLS). Hasil penelitian menunjukkan bahwa Perpuatan Aktiva Tetap berpengaruh terhadap ROA , ROE dan tidak berpengaruh terhadap NPM. Hutang Jangka Pendek tidak berpengaruh terhadap ROA ,ROE dan berpengaruh terhadap NPM. Hutang Jangka Panjang tidak berpengaruh terhadap ROA, ROE dan NPM. Ukuran Perusahaan (Size) tidak berpengaruh terhadap ROA, ROE dan NPM

Evaluación formativa y logro de aprendizaje en ciencia y tecnología del 4º de secundaria de la I.E. 20955-14 - Huarochirí 2021
En el estudio titulado “Evaluación formativa y logro de aprendizaje en ciencia y tecnología del 4º de secundaria de la I.E. 20955-14 - Huarochirí 2021”, donde el objetivo general de la investigación es determinar la relación entre la evaluación formativa y los logros de aprendizaje en el área de ciencia y tecnología en el 4º de secundaria de la IE Nº 20955-14 Sagrado Corazón de Jesús - Ugel 15 - Huarochirí, 2021.
El estudio es de tipo básico, el nivel es descriptivo correlacional, un diseño no-experimental transversal y enfoque cuantitativo, 50 alumnos de 4º de secundaria conformaron la muestra, utilizó como técnica la encuesta, el instrumento para recolectar los datos en la variable Evaluación formativa es el cuestionario, y en la variable Logro de aprendizaje el registro de notas académicas. Se utilizó el juicio de expertos para la validación del instrumento, se aplicó el alfa de Cronbach donde se obtuvo un 0.938 para la variable evaluación formativa, asegurando su alta confiabilidad.
Sobre el objetivo general, se concluyó que existe relación entre ambas variables de manera significativa, dicho resultado se muestra en el estadístico de Spearman (Sig. bilateral=,000 <0,05, Rho = ,570**
A somatic-mutational process recurrently duplicates germline susceptibility loci and tissue-specific super-enhancers in breast cancers
Somatic rearrangements contribute to the mutagenized landscape of cancer genomes. Here, we systematically interrogated rearrangements in 560 breast cancers by using a piecewise constant fitting approach. We identified 33 hotspots of large (>100 kb) tandem duplications, a mutational signature associated with homologous-recombination-repair deficiency. Notably, these tandem-duplication hotspots were enriched in breast cancer germline susceptibility loci (odds ratio (OR) = 4.28) and breast-specific 'super-enhancer' regulatory elements (OR = 3.54). A whole-genome sequence and transcriptome perspective on HER2-positive breast cancers
HER2-positive breast cancer has long proven to be a clinically distinct class of breast cancers for which several targeted therapies are now available. However, resistance to the treatment associated with specific gene expressions or mutations has been observed, revealing the underlying diversity of these cancers. Therefore, understanding the full extent of the HER2-positive disease heterogeneity still remains challenging. Here we carry out an in-depth genomic characterization of 64 HER2-positive breast tumour genomes that exhibit four subgroups, based on the expression data, with distinctive genomic features in terms of somatic mutations, copy-number changes or structural variations. The results suggest that, despite being clinically defined by a specific gene amplification, HER2-positive tumours melt into the whole luminal-basal breast cancer spectrum rather than standing apart. The results also lead to a refined ERBB2 amplicon of 106 kb and show that several cases of amplifications are compatible with a breakage-fusion-bridge mechanism
Kajian Ekonomi Penanganan Sedimen Pada Waduk Seri Di Sungai Brantas (Sengguruh, Sutami Dan Wlingi)
Sengguruh, Sutami and Wlingi, were series of three reservoirs in the upper Brantas River which have a high rate of sedimentation, thus research should be carried out to determine the proper method of sediment handling which could maintain the benefit function of reservoirs as well as feasible from economic perspective.
Processing data and data analysis was performed to determine the condition of reservoir capacity, sedimentation rate, the amount of sediment handling and most feasible alternatives on sediment handling. The analyzes carried out in two phases, first phases to the existing condition and the second phases to four (4) alternatives of sediment handling at ten years project work. Alternative 1 is sediment handling with a volume of 1 million cum/year, while Alternative 2, Alternative 3, and Alternative 4 is sediment handling with volume equals to annual sedimentation rate with variation on different work method. The average sedimentation rate in those reservoirs on the last 20 years reaching a massive 1.7 million cum/ year. Hence, routine sediment handling with dredging and flushing work should to be done with minimal volume at 1.7 million cum/year. The result of economic analysis show that alternative 3 with B/C = 1.03, IRR = 17.35% and NPV = Rp. 6.37 Billion in the alternative with volume of sediment handled equals to sedimentation rate and feasible from economic perspective.

Flood management analysis in the Ngasinan River, Trenggalek Regency, Indonesia
Flood event occurs during the rainy season when water volume increases because rainwater flows through the water channel; due to water volume being larger than the water channel capacity, this event can cause flood inundation through residential areas. The Ngasinan catchment at Trenggalek Regency experienced a flood event that affected thousands of lives in October 2022, to reduce the impact of future floods, this study objective carried out recommendation plans for flood management in the Ngasinan River. The Ngasinan catchment hydrology, maximum annual rainfall from 230.0 mm to 585.0 mm, flood discharge design for the Ngasinan river (river length 21.73 km as main river drainage) are Q25 = 318.64 m3/s, Q100 = 394.96 m3/s. Hydraulic simulation using flood discharge design Q25 -Q100 showed that flood occurs in Ngasinan River sections especially those without embankments or at lower river elevations and cross-sections. Recommendation plans for the Ngasinan River flood management are river normalization, river embankment repairs, residential drainage system, and construction of dams/reservoirs/retarding basins, expected to restore the river’s storage capacity due to sedimentation and destructive flood discharge also to reduce flood discharge, protect river channel banks against flood discharge, and prevent overtopping water into nearby land
